pub enum CaskRecordSignalsKind {
Topics,
SessionCount,
RecordedMessageCount,
RecordedMessageSize,
}Variants§
Topics
List of available topics as a comma separate string
SessionCount
Number of active writers. If this is greater than 1 it means recording is in progress.
RecordedMessageCount
Total number of messages recorded. If messages are written to multiple casks they are counted multiple times.
RecordedMessageSize
Total number of bytes recorded. If messages are written to multiple casks they are counted multiple time.
Trait Implementations§
Source§impl Clone for CaskRecordSignalsKind
impl Clone for CaskRecordSignalsKind
Source§fn clone(&self) -> CaskRecordSignalsKind
fn clone(&self) -> CaskRecordSignalsKind
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for CaskRecordSignalsKind
impl Debug for CaskRecordSignalsKind
Source§impl<'de> Deserialize<'de> for CaskRecordSignalsKind
impl<'de> Deserialize<'de> for CaskRecordSignalsKind
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l Hash for CaskRecordSignalsKind
impl Hash for CaskRecordSignalsKind
Source§impl PartialEq for CaskRecordSignalsKind
impl PartialEq for CaskRecordSignalsKind
Source§impl Serialize for CaskRecordSignalsKind
impl Serialize for CaskRecordSignalsKind
Source§impl SignalKind for CaskRecordSignalsKind
impl SignalKind for CaskRecordSignalsKind
Source§fn dtype(&self) -> SignalDataType
fn dtype(&self) -> SignalDataType
The data type of this field
impl Copy for CaskRecordSignalsKind
impl Eq for CaskRecordSignalsKind
impl StructuralPartialEq for CaskRecordSignalsKind
Auto Trait Implementations§
impl Freeze for CaskRecordSignalsKind
impl RefUnwindSafe for CaskRecordSignalsKind
impl Send for CaskRecordSignalsKind
impl Sync for CaskRecordSignalsKind
impl Unpin for CaskRecordSignalsKind
impl UnwindSafe for CaskRecordSignalsKind
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more